Search Marketing Strategies: A Marketer's Guide to Objective Driven Success from Search Engines

Search Marketing Strategies: A Marketer's Guide to Objective Driven Success from Search Engines
Search Marketing Strategies focuses on how to make the most from the search engine industry. Concentrating on the strategic element rather than the procedural approach, the author demonstrates how to adapt the tactical techniques, such as paid search, site side optimization and analytics packages, into search strategies in order to achieve marketing or corporate objectives such as branding, sales and customer acquisition.

Search engine marketing - In Internet marketing, search engine marketing, or SEM, is a set of marketing methods to increase the visibility of a website in search engine results pages (SERPs). The three main methods are:

Yahoo! Search - Yahoo! Search is a web search engine, owned by Yahoo!.

Internet marketing - Internet marketing is the use of the Internet to advertise and sell goods and services. Internet Marketing includes pay per click advertising, banner ads, e-mail marketing, search engine marketing (including search engine optimization), blog marketing, and article marketing.

At its peak in early 2004, Google has indexed 4.28 billion webpages, 880 million images and 845 million Usenet messages a total of six billion items. Google gained a following among Internet users for its simple, clean design and relevant search results. Google's code of conduct is Don't be evil. It also caches much of the content that it indexes. While many of its dot-com siblings went under, Google quietly rose in stature while turning a profit. In February 2003, Google acquired Pyra Labs, owner of Blogger, a pioneering and leading weblog-hosting website.
